Setlist: 2006-10-01 - The Broken Axe; Moorhead, MN
« on: October 02, 2006, 06:39:18 am »
I: Frankly Po Zest > Great Big Fiery Ball In The Sky > Frankly Po Zest, Psygn, jam > Inner Glimpse > Episode 3 (Awakening)

II: Honey Butter, jam > The Vermont Song, jam > Beef Barley, No Regret > Lit > Wild Pack Of Asscracks

E: Space City Affair > Intension
